Making Short Term Drug Treatment Work in Ellsworth, Minnesota

For many people, completing short term treatment means that you need to carry on with additional rehabilitation services such as through 12-step meetings or individualized counseling. Usually, addiction recovery is a long-term commitment. This means that you might want to continue with your treatment in other settings for some time - depending on how confident you are in your sobriety, your determination, and your health.

As such, the step-down method after going through a short term rehab program will involve other types of treatment, including but not limited to:

  • Intensive outpatient programs (IOP)
  • Partial hospitalization programs (PHP)
  • Halfway houses
  • Sober living homes
  • Support groups
  • Outpatient treatments

In fact, even after you have graduated from a short term substance abuse treatment program and have started transitioning into a new healthy lifestyle, you may still require continued support and aftercare services. You might find these in group settings, such as by regularly attending 12-step meetings, or in an individual environment such as one on one counseling or outpatient therapy.

In general, the longer you stay committed to the treatment protocol, the greater your chances of successful recovery will be.
